About Ermington 2115

The size of Ermington is approximately 3.8 square kilometres. There are 17 parks, covering nearly 15.6% of the total area. The population of Ermington in 2016 was 10737 people. By 2021 the population was 12686 showing a population growth of 18.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ermington is 30-39 years. Households in Ermington are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ermington work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 55.00% of the homes in Ermington were owner-occupied compared with 57.50% in 2016.

Ermington has 5,365 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Ermington have seen a 21.34%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 7.66%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Ermington is $1,836,204 while the median value for Units is $799,377.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,050 while Units have a median rent of $755.
There are currently 31 properties listed for sale, and 15 properties listed for rent in Ermington on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 199 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Ermington.
